KENNESAW, Ga. – Kennesaw State's
Fabeon Tucker won his second consecutive ASUN Conference Men's Indoor Field Athlete of the Week award following his performance Mountaineer NCAA Indoor Meet the conference announced Wednesday.
In his lone event of the weekend, Tucker won the weight throw with a career-best toss of 19.35m (63'6). That throw was the second-farthest in school history and .43m off the current school record. That throw currently leads the ASUN by 4.5m and over 13 feet. The throw is also the 47
th farthest in the NCAA this season.
Tucker and the Owls will take this weekend off from competition before heading to Massachusetts to compete at the Harvard Crimson Elite Meet on Friday, Feb.3, and the BU Scarlet and White on Saturday, Feb.4.
